3 / 22 page ELECTRICAL CHARACTERISTICS TPS767D3xx www.ti.com......................................................................................................................................................... SLVS209H – JULY 1999 – REVISED AUGUST 2008 Over operating temperature range (TJ = –40°C to +125°C), VIN = VOUT(nom) + 1V, IOUT = 1mA, VEN = 0V, and COUT = 10µF, unless otherwise noted. Adjustable channels are set to VOUT = 3.3V. Typical values are at TJ = 25°C. PARAMETER TEST CONDITIONS MIN TYP MAX UNIT VIN Input voltage range, V1IN, V2IN (1) 2.7 10 V Adjustable VOUT range, V1OUT, V2OUT 1.5 5.5 V VOUT + 1V ≤ VIN ≤ 5.5V; Accuracy, adjustable VOUT channels (1) –2.0 +2.0 % VOUT 10 µA ≤ I OUT ≤ 1A VOUT + 1V ≤ VIN ≤ 10V; Accuracy, fixed VOUT channels (1) –2.0 +2.0 % 10 µA ≤ I OUT ≤ 1A ΔVOUT%/ΔVIN Line regulation(1) VOUT + 1.0V ≤ VIN ≤ 10V 0.01 %/V ΔVOUT%/ΔIOUT Load regulation 10 µA ≤ I OUT ≤ 1A 3 mV Dropout voltage(2) VDO VOUT = 3.3V, IOUT = 1A 350 575 mV (VIN = VOUT (nom) – 0.1V) ICL Output current limit, per LDO VOUT = 0V, TJ = +25°C 1.7 2 A IGND Ground pin current, per LDO 10 µA ≤ I OUT ≤ 1A 85 125 µA ISHDN Standby current, per LDO 2.7V ≤ VIN ≤ 10V, VEN = VIN 1 10 µA IFB FB current input (Adjustable) VFB = 1.5V 2 nA PSRR Power-supply ripple rejection f = 1kHz, COUT = 10µF 60 dB BW = 200Hz to 100kHz, VOUT = 1.8V, VN Output noise voltage 55 µV RMS IC = 1A, COUT = 10µF VEN(HI) High-level enable input voltage TJ = +25°C 2.0 V VEN(LO) Low-level enable input voltage TJ = +25°C 0.8 V VEN = 0V, TJ = +25°C –1 0 1 IEN Input current µA VEN = VIN, TJ = +25°C –1 1 Minimum input voltage for valid IOUT(RESET) = 300µA 1.1 V RESET Trip threshold voltage VOUT decreasing, TJ = +25°C 92 98 %VOUT Hysteresis voltage Measured at VOUT 0.5 %VOUT Reset VI = 2.7V, TJ = +25°C, Output low voltage 0.15 0.4 V IOUT(RESET)= 1mA Leakage current V(RESET) = 7V, TJ = +25°C 1 µA RESET time-out delay TJ = +25°C 100 200 400 ms TSD Thermal shutdown temperature 150 °C TJ Operating junction temperature –40 +125 °C (1) Minimum VIN = VOUT + VDO or 2.7V, whichever is greater. (2) Dropout voltage (VDO) is not measured for channels with VOUT(nom) < 2.8V since minimum VIN = 2.7V. Copyright © 1999–2008, Texas Instruments Incorporated Submit Documentation Feedback 3 |
